TOUCH WOOD

During this year’s Salone del Mobile, we were delighted to stage a celebration of emerging talent in the worlds of furniture and product design (see page 166 for the result). For the exhibition – entitled ‘Class of 24’ and held at the Triennale – we called on a long-term collaborator, American Hardwood Export Council (AHEC), which felt like a natural step, given its unstoppable drive to experiment with timber, and its continuous support of diverse approaches to making by next-generation creatives.

As part of the exhibition, AHEC worked closely with two designers, Giles Tettey Nartey and Eleanor Hill, of Parti Studio, to create new bodies of work in American maple. Made in collaboration with London-based furniture maker Jan Hendzel, the pieces reflected both Nartey’s and Hill’s ongoing visual and cultural design research, while highlighting the qualities and potential of the chosen timber. ‘American hard maple is part of a wider narrative of underused species,’ says AHEC’s European director David Venables. One of his missions is to stress the importance of considering these timbers. ‘There is a myth that trees live forever, but [by not using the wood], you’re leaving some of your most valuable material in the forest to decay.’
